What a day looks like without AI agents vs with AI agents

The same outbound work, but with less chasing, fewer delays, and cleaner handoffs.

Without AI agents

Reps spend the first hour pulling lists from spreadsheets, checking titles, and fixing bad contact data before outreach can even start.
Follow-up emails and call notes sit in inboxes or Slack threads, so prospects get contacted late or not at all.
Managers manually review replies, sort interested leads from no-shows, and decide who gets the next touch.
The CRM is updated at the end of the day, which means activity logs, statuses, and next steps are often incomplete or inconsistent.

With AI agents

New prospect lists are cleaned and prioritized as soon as they arrive, so reps start with usable contacts instead of messy files.
Replies, call outcomes, and meeting requests are sorted and routed quickly, so hot leads get a fast next step.
Follow-up tasks are drafted and queued automatically, so no-shows, objections, and warm replies do not sit untouched.
CRM fields, notes, and handoff details are updated during the workflow, so managers can see pipeline status without chasing the team.

A real outbound workflow from first trigger to booked meeting

This is the kind of repeatable workflow an outbound sales agency already runs every day.

01
Trigger — A client sends a new account list, ICP sheet, or lead export.

1. New target list arrives

The agent checks the list for missing titles, bad emails, duplicate contacts, and obvious mismatches before the team starts outreach.
